Starting a "Angels With Special Needs Organization" chapter can be established in any community, regardless of location or size. All that is required is a group of dedicated people willing to give their time and talents to help provide activities for children/youths in their community.
It is important to note that Angels With Special Needs is a volunteer organization and AWSN Chapters operate with no paid staff.
 
If you are interested in serving as the volunteer leader of a new chapter, the Founder of AWSN will provide the appropriate direction, information, and materials to begin operation. The volunteer leader - commonly referred to as Area Coordinator - will serve as supervisor for the chapter's day-to-day operations and as the liaison with the Founder of AWSN.

To begin the process of establishing a new AWSN Chapter:

  • Contact the AWSN Organization Founder to inform them of your desire to establish a new chapter.
  • Begin to assemble a core group of volunteers to serve as officers of the chapter. (Consideration should be given to the importance of including an attorney, and accountant, in this core group.)
  • Complete the Chapter Contract which will be produced and forwarded to you by the AWSN Organization and return it as soon as possible. This documentation authorizes you to operate as a AWSN Chapter, within the bylaws of our organization. After your signed contract is received by the AWSN Organization, you will be sent a copy of the Standard Operating Procedures Manual and other appropriate documents to assist in your chapter's development.
  • Secure a local address and telephone number to which interested volunteers, AWSN applicants, and donors can be referred.
  • Establish an account in AWSN name at a local bank.
  • Hold a general organization meeting to stimulate interest in AWSN in your community and identify potential volunteers. A representative of the AWSN Organization will be available for contact answer questions, provide appropriate direction and help you on the way to providing your chapter's first service.
